Cyborgs

Besides the rise of robots in healthcare, in the near future we may also encounter cyborgs on the street or become one ourselves. A cyborg is partly human and partly machine and these are already in the making! As human beings we become more and more physically equipped with techniques that remove a certain limitation or make our bodies stronger.

In principle, this now only happens for medical purposes, for example if a heart no longer works properly or if someone is disabled. The patient then receives a pacemaker or a prosthesis. Some prosthetics can even be controlled by the wearer with the brain. Sounds are already emerging that our brain can be connected to the cloud in the future. Anyway, we are getting more and more opportunities to tinker with the body and the senses.
